⚠️ Important Installation Notes:
- A Suspension Engineering Panhard Rod Relocation Kit is required for this system to clear over the rear axle. Available in Black or Red — select your color at checkout
- Designed to work with Speed Engineering 1-3/4" and 1-7/8" F-body longtube headers only — not compatible with factory exhaust manifolds. Also fits eBay, OBX, and PaceSetter style longtube headers
- 1982–1992 F-body LS swap applications — this system can also be used with modification at the collectors
- Lowered vehicles may require modification for proper ground clearance
